Lightweight Innovations
Moreover, CNC machining expedites the production of lightweight materials critical to aerospace endeavors. It's the linchpin for forging titanium and composite components that ensure durability without compromising efficiency. This weight reduction is a game-changer, enhancing aircraft range, payload, and environmental sustainability.
Precision in the Cosmos
In the realm of space exploration, CNC machining's role is equally profound. It fabricates intricate components for spacecraft, satellites, and rovers, embodying the precision required to navigate the cosmos. The technology's ability to withstand extreme conditions, such as those in space, contributes to mission success.
